How to Create a QR Code for Your Website (+ Website Hosting Cost Breakdown)

When launching a website, one of the crucial decisions you‘ll make is choosing a web hosting service. However, with numerous options available and varying price points, understanding website hosting costs can be overwhelming, especially for beginners. In this ultimate guide, we‘ll break down the different types of website hosting, factors affecting costs, and provide you with actionable advice to help you make an informed decision.

What is Website Hosting and Why is it Important?

Website hosting is a service that allows your website to be accessible on the internet. It involves storing your website files on a server and providing the necessary technology and support to keep your site up and running. Without website hosting, your site would not be visible to online visitors.

Understanding website hosting costs is essential because it directly impacts your budget and the overall performance of your website. Choosing the right hosting plan can ensure your site loads quickly, remains secure, and can handle the expected traffic. On the other hand, selecting a plan that doesn‘t meet your needs can lead to slow loading times, frequent downtime, and potential security vulnerabilities.

Types of Website Hosting

There are several types of website hosting available, each with its own advantages, disadvantages, and average costs. Let‘s explore the most common options:

1. Shared Hosting

Shared hosting is the most affordable and popular option, particularly for small websites and blogs. With shared hosting, your website shares a server and its resources with other websites. This means that the costs are divided among multiple users, making it an economical choice.


  • Low cost (average monthly cost: $2 to $10)
  • Easy to set up and manage
  • Suitable for websites with low to moderate traffic


  • Limited resources (CPU, RAM, storage)
  • Potential performance issues if other websites on the same server experience high traffic
  • Less customization and control over the server environment

2. VPS Hosting

VPS (Virtual Private Server) hosting provides a middle ground between shared hosting and dedicated hosting. With VPS hosting, your website is hosted on a virtual partition of a server, which means you have dedicated resources allocated to your site.


  • More resources and better performance than shared hosting
  • Greater customization and control over the server environment
  • Ability to scale resources as your website grows


  • Higher cost compared to shared hosting (average monthly cost: $20 to $100)
  • Requires more technical knowledge to manage and configure

3. Dedicated Hosting

Dedicated hosting offers the highest level of performance, security, and control. With dedicated hosting, your website is hosted on a physical server that is exclusively dedicated to your site. This means you have full control over the server‘s resources and configuration.


  • Maximum performance and resources
  • Highest level of security and privacy
  • Full control over the server environment


  • Most expensive option (average monthly cost: $100 to $1000+)
  • Requires technical expertise to manage and maintain the server

4. Cloud Hosting

Cloud hosting is a newer type of hosting that utilizes a network of interconnected servers to host websites. With cloud hosting, your website‘s resources are spread across multiple servers, allowing for greater flexibility and scalability.


  • High scalability and flexibility
  • Reliable performance with minimal downtime
  • Pay-as-you-go pricing model based on resource usage


  • Can be more expensive than traditional hosting options, depending on resource usage
  • Requires technical knowledge to set up and manage effectively

5. WordPress Hosting

WordPress hosting is a specialized type of hosting optimized for WordPress websites. It offers features and resources specifically tailored to enhance the performance and security of WordPress sites.


  • Optimized for WordPress performance and security
  • Often includes automatic WordPress updates and backups
  • User-friendly management interfaces and tools


  • Can be more expensive than general shared hosting (average monthly cost: $5 to $50)
  • Limited flexibility for non-WordPress websites or custom configurations

Factors Affecting Website Hosting Costs

Several factors can impact the cost of website hosting. Understanding these factors can help you make informed decisions and choose a hosting plan that fits your needs and budget.

1. Website Traffic and Resource Usage

The amount of traffic your website receives and the resources it consumes play a significant role in determining your hosting costs. Websites with higher traffic and resource-intensive applications will require more robust hosting plans, which come at a higher price point.

2. Storage and Bandwidth Requirements

The storage space and bandwidth you need for your website also affect hosting costs. If your site contains a large number of files, images, or videos, you‘ll require more storage space. Similarly, if you expect a high volume of traffic, you‘ll need more bandwidth to accommodate the data transfer.

3. Security Features

Essential security features like SSL certificates, regular backups, and malware scanning can add to your hosting costs. However, investing in these features is crucial to protect your website and user data from potential threats.

4. Additional Services

Some hosting providers offer additional services such as email hosting, domain registration, and website builders. These services can be bundled with your hosting plan or offered as add-ons, which can increase your overall hosting expenses.

5. Managed vs. Unmanaged Hosting

Managed hosting services provide a higher level of support, including server management, updates, and technical assistance. While managed hosting can be more expensive, it can save you time and effort in maintaining your website. Unmanaged hosting, on the other hand, requires you to handle server management tasks yourself, which can be more cost-effective if you have the necessary technical skills.

Average Website Hosting Costs

To give you a better idea of the average costs associated with each type of hosting, we‘ve compiled a table with data from various reliable sources:

Hosting Type Average Monthly Cost Yearly Cost
Shared $2 – $10 $24 – $120
VPS $20 – $100 $240 – $1,200
Dedicated $100 – $1,000+ $1,200 – $12,000+
Cloud Pay-as-you-go, varies based on usage
WordPress $5 – $50 $60 – $600

It‘s important to note that these are average costs, and actual prices may vary depending on the hosting provider, plan specifications, and any promotions or discounts available.

Based on the data, shared hosting remains the most affordable option, making it a popular choice for small websites and blogs. As websites grow and require more resources, VPS and dedicated hosting become more suitable, albeit at a higher cost. Cloud hosting pricing varies based on usage, making it a flexible option for websites with dynamic resource needs. WordPress hosting falls in the middle range, providing specialized features for WordPress sites.

When choosing a hosting plan, it‘s essential to consider your website‘s current needs and anticipate future growth. While it may be tempting to opt for the cheapest plan available, it‘s crucial to ensure that the hosting provider can accommodate your website‘s requirements and offer reliable performance.

Choosing the Right Website Hosting Plan

With a better understanding of the different types of hosting and the factors affecting costs, let‘s explore how to choose the right website hosting plan for your needs.

1. Assess Your Website‘s Needs

Start by evaluating your website‘s current and future requirements. Consider factors such as:

  • Expected traffic volume
  • Storage and bandwidth needs
  • Required performance and speed
  • Security and reliability expectations
  • Scalability for future growth

2. Consider Your Budget

Determine how much you can allocate to website hosting on a monthly or yearly basis. Keep in mind that while cheaper plans may be attractive initially, they may not provide the necessary resources or performance for your website in the long run.

3. Look for Essential Features

When comparing hosting plans, look for essential features that ensure the smooth operation and security of your website. These may include:

  • Adequate storage and bandwidth
  • High uptime guarantee (99.9% or above)
  • Reliable customer support
  • Regular backups and disaster recovery
  • SSL certificates for secure data transmission

4. Read Reviews and Compare Providers

Research and compare different hosting providers to find the one that best aligns with your needs and budget. Read reviews from other users to gauge the provider‘s reliability, performance, and customer support. Don‘t hesitate to reach out to the provider with any questions or concerns before making a decision.

Tips for Optimizing Website Hosting Costs

Once you‘ve chosen a website hosting plan, there are several ways to optimize your hosting costs and ensure you‘re getting the most value for your money.

1. Start with a Plan That Meets Your Current Needs

When starting, choose a hosting plan that meets your website‘s current needs rather than overestimating and paying for resources you won‘t use. As your website grows, you can always upgrade to a higher-tier plan.

2. Regularly Monitor Your Resource Usage

Keep an eye on your website‘s resource usage, including storage space, bandwidth, and CPU usage. If you consistently reach or exceed your plan‘s limits, consider upgrading to a plan with more resources to avoid performance issues or additional fees.

3. Implement Caching and Optimize Your Website

Implement caching techniques and optimize your website‘s code and images to reduce the load on your server resources. This can help improve your website‘s performance and potentially allow you to stay on a lower-tier hosting plan for longer.

4. Consider Long-Term Contracts

Many hosting providers offer discounts for long-term contracts. If you‘re confident in your hosting choice and plan to keep your website running for an extended period, consider signing up for a yearly or multi-year contract to save on overall costs.

5. Look for Promotions and Discounts

Keep an eye out for promotions, discounts, or coupons offered by hosting providers. These can help reduce your initial or ongoing hosting costs. However, be sure to read the fine print and understand any limitations or requirements associated with the promotions.


Understanding website hosting costs is crucial for anyone looking to launch or maintain a website. By familiarizing yourself with the different types of hosting, factors affecting costs, and average price ranges, you can make informed decisions and choose a hosting plan that fits your needs and budget.

Remember to assess your website‘s requirements, consider your budget, and look for essential features when selecting a hosting provider. Additionally, implementing cost optimization techniques can help you get the most value from your hosting plan.

Investing in the right website hosting plan not only ensures the smooth operation of your site but also provides a foundation for future growth and success. By taking the time to understand and manage your hosting costs effectively, you can focus on creating valuable content and delivering an exceptional user experience to your visitors.